The invention discloses a tea garden multifunctional adjustable ditching and fertilizing machine, which comprises a frame, a ditch opener, a fertilization device and a support mechanism; the ditch opener, the fertilization device and the support mechanism are all arranged on the frame; the lower end of the support mechanism Equipped with a ground wheel or a soil cover device; the ditch opener includes a rotary tillage power input gear, a rotary tillage shaft, a knife seat and a rotary tillage blade; the knife seat and rotary tillage blades are in multiple groups; the rotary tillage power input gear is fixed on the rotary tillage shaft, The rotary tillage shaft is installed on the frame through the bearing seat and the bearing, the rotary tiller blade is fixed on the rotary tiller shaft through the knife seat, and the power input shaft is connected with the rotary tiller power input gear transmission to drive the rotary tiller shaft. The tea garden multifunctional and adjustable ditching and fertilizing machine has combined functions of weeding, tea garden shallow and deep fertilization and ditching, with rich functions and good practicability.

背景技术 Background technique

我国是世界上绿茶第一生产大国,根据国家统计局统计,2008年全国茶园面积1719.4239千公顷,茶叶年产量为125.76万吨。目前,随着我国农村劳动力减少和手工作业效率较低,茶园中耕除草、植保、施肥、修剪、采摘等环节劳动力短缺、成本加大,给我国茶业的发展带来巨大的挑战。我国大部分茶园分布在山区和丘陵地区,茶树单一、条栽种植对机械提出了特殊要求,现有的田间作业机械因动力不足和自身体积较大而很难进入茶园行间作业,满足要求的茶园作业机械设备严重缺乏,对功率大、效率高、体积小、自重小、传动平稳、适应坡地工作环境的茶园机械设备需求越来越迫切。my country is the largest producer of green tea in the world. According to the statistics of the National Bureau of Statistics, in 2008, the national tea garden area was 17.194239 million hectares, and the annual output of tea was 1.2576 million tons. At present, with the reduction of the rural labor force in my country and the low efficiency of manual operations, there is a shortage of labor and increased costs in tea garden cultivation, weeding, plant protection, fertilization, pruning, and picking, which poses a huge challenge to the development of my country's tea industry. Most of the tea gardens in my country are distributed in mountainous and hilly areas. The single tea tree and row planting put forward special requirements for machinery. The existing field operation machinery is difficult to enter the tea garden due to insufficient power and large size. There is a serious shortage of tea garden operation machinery and equipment, and the demand for tea garden machinery and equipment with high power, high efficiency, small size, light weight, stable transmission, and adaptable to the working environment on slopes is becoming more and more urgent.

国家专利号CN200820053798.6公布了一种人工推动可调式施肥机;国家专利号CN200920015757.2公布了一种电动施肥器;国家专利号CN200920284631.5公布了一种电动喷药施肥两用器;很多文献也报道了施肥的研究结果,如曲桂宝《变量施肥机的试验研究》。但我国大部分茶园分布在山区和丘陵地区,道路路况差,许多茶园履带式行走装置都不能使用;茶树单一、条栽种植,茶树行间距离较窄约40cm,也不适用大型拖拉机作业;目前缺少专用适合我国茶园作业的小型施肥机。因此,有必要开发一种茶园多功能可调开沟施肥机来满足茶园机械作业农艺要求,要求设计合理、结构简单、操作方便、自动控制、工作效率高。National Patent No. CN200820053798.6 has announced a kind of manually propelled adjustable fertilizer; National Patent No. CN200920015757.2 has announced a kind of electric fertilizer; The literature also reports the research results of fertilization, such as Qu Guibao's "Experimental Research on Variable Fertilizer". However, most of the tea gardens in my country are distributed in mountainous and hilly areas. The road conditions are poor, and many tea gardens cannot use crawler-type walking devices; the tea trees are single and planted in strips, and the distance between tea tree rows is narrow about 40cm, and large tractors are not suitable for operation; currently There is a lack of special small-scale fertilizer spreaders suitable for my country's tea garden operations. Therefore, it is necessary to develop a tea garden multifunctional and adjustable ditching and fertilizing machine to meet the agronomic requirements of tea garden mechanical operations, requiring reasonable design, simple structure, convenient operation, automatic control, and high work efficiency.

具体实施方式 Detailed ways

以下结合附图对本发明作进一步说明。The present invention will be further described below in conjunction with accompanying drawing.

实施例1:Example 1:

如图1-6所示,一种茶园多功能可调开沟施肥机,包括机架和设置在机架上的松土开沟装置和施肥装置;机架通过机架挂件的销连接在拖拉机上。As shown in Figure 1-6, a tea garden multifunctional adjustable ditching and fertilizing machine includes a frame and a soil loosening and ditching device and a fertilizing device arranged on the frame; the frame is connected to the tractor through the pin of the frame pendant superior.

松土开沟装置包括动力、开沟器和调节附件;动力从拖拉机通过链条连接动力输入齿轮31,动力输入齿轮31一端安装在动力输入齿轮内套轴承30上,另一端加工出与牙嵌离合器32相啮合的啮合齿;动力输入齿轮内套轴承30安装在动力输入轴28上,动力轴28通过轴承座和轴承固定在机架上,与动力输入齿轮同一端为花键轴,安装牙嵌式离合器;旋耕动力输入齿轮安装在输入动力齿轮内套轴承上,通过牙嵌式离合器结合将动力传输到动力输入轴的动力输出齿轮35上;通过安装在离合器拨叉支点上的拨叉分离牙嵌式离合器停止动力输出;在压缩弹簧33的作用下,牙嵌式离合器在常态下处于啮合动力传输状态;动力输出齿轮35通过链条传输动力到旋耕动力输入齿轮38上;The soil loosening and ditching device includes power, openers and adjustment accessories; the power is connected to the power input gear 31 from the tractor through a chain, and one end of the power input gear 31 is installed on the inner sleeve bearing 30 of the power input gear, and the other end is processed to be connected with the jaw clutch. 32 meshing meshing teeth; the power input gear inner sleeve bearing 30 is installed on the power input shaft 28, the power shaft 28 is fixed on the frame through the bearing seat and the bearing, and the same end as the power input gear is a spline shaft, and the tooth insert is installed type clutch; the rotary tillage power input gear is installed on the inner sleeve bearing of the input power gear, and the power is transmitted to the power output gear 35 of the power input shaft through the jaw clutch combination; it is separated by the shift fork installed on the fulcrum of the clutch shift fork The jaw clutch stops the power output; under the action of the compression spring 33, the jaw clutch is in the meshing power transmission state under normal conditions; the power output gear 35 transmits power to the rotary tillage power input gear 38 through a chain;

开沟器包括旋耕动力输入齿轮、旋耕轴、旋耕刀片和附件,旋耕动力输入齿轮固定在旋耕轴25上,旋耕轴通过轴承座和轴承安装在机架上,旋耕刀片通过螺栓固定在刀座上,刀座焊接固定在旋耕刀座套筒上,旋耕刀座套筒通过螺栓固定在旋耕轴上来实现动力传输。在旋耕刀片的作用下,实现土壤开沟、松土功能。调节附件包括地轮、高度调节的螺纹轴和螺纹套筒;地轮通过连接板固定在螺纹轴上,螺纹套筒焊接在机架上,通过旋转把手,驱动螺纹轴旋转来改变地轮距机架高度,固定螺丝固定后,就确定了土壤松土开沟的深度;另外,在道路行驶时,可以调高机架高度,使旋转刀片不与地面摩擦或碰撞。在道路行驶时,地轮着地,整个图1的机械挂装在拖拉机的后端,利用拖拉机的车轮来平衡本机械。The ditch opener includes a rotary tillage power input gear, a rotary tiller shaft, a rotary tiller blade and accessories, the rotary tiller power input gear is fixed on the rotary tiller shaft 25, the rotary tiller shaft is installed on the frame through a bearing seat and a bearing, and the rotary tiller blade It is fixed on the knife seat by bolts, the knife seat is welded and fixed on the rotary tiller knife seat sleeve, and the rotary tiller knife seat sleeve is fixed on the rotary tiller shaft by bolts to realize power transmission. Under the action of the rotary tiller blade, the functions of soil ditching and soil loosening are realized. The adjustment accessories include the ground wheel, the threaded shaft and the threaded sleeve for height adjustment; the ground wheel is fixed on the threaded shaft through the connecting plate, and the threaded sleeve is welded on the frame, and the ground track can be changed by rotating the handle to drive the threaded shaft to rotate After the fixing screw is fixed, the depth of soil loosening and ditching is determined; in addition, when driving on the road, the height of the rack can be adjusted so that the rotating blade does not rub or collide with the ground. When driving on the road, the ground wheel touches the ground, and the machinery of the whole Figure 1 is mounted on the rear end of the tractor, and the wheels of the tractor are used to balance the machinery.

施肥装置通过施肥装置挂件和支撑块固定施肥架在机架上方,包括施肥动力系统、肥料斗、施肥动力轴、排肥轮和下肥器;施肥动力采用蓄电池直流电机驱动;施肥动力系统由蓄电池给安装在电机固定架上的直流电机提供电源,通过开关启动和停止供电,直流电机通过惯用技术调节电机齿轮输出转速带动施肥器驱动齿轮,施肥驱动齿固定在施肥轴上,施肥轴通过轴承座和轴承固定在施肥架上;施肥轴十字键轴处带动拨肥轮转动,在拨肥轮作用下,实施施肥,并通过调节电机转速改变拨肥轮的转速来改变施肥量;肥料通过下肥管和浅施肥开沟器施肥,并通过覆土器进行覆土。The fertilization device fixes the fertilization frame above the frame through the fertilization device pendant and support block, including the fertilization power system, fertilizer hopper, fertilization power shaft, fertilizer discharge wheel and fertilizer lowering device; the fertilization power is driven by a battery DC motor; the fertilization power system is driven by a battery Provide power to the DC motor installed on the motor fixing frame, start and stop the power supply through the switch, the DC motor adjusts the output speed of the motor gear through the conventional technology to drive the drive gear of the fertilizer applicator, the fertilization drive gear is fixed on the fertilization shaft, and the fertilization shaft passes through the bearing seat The fertilization shaft and the bearing are fixed on the fertilization rack; the cross key shaft of the fertilization shaft drives the fertilizer wheel to rotate, and under the action of the fertilizer wheel, fertilization is carried out, and the amount of fertilizer is changed by adjusting the speed of the motor to change the speed of the fertilizer wheel; the fertilizer is passed through the fertilizer Fertilize with pipes and shallow fertilization openers, and cover with soil through mulchers.

排肥舌安装在拨肥轮下方,一端通过销固定在外壳上,另一端即下肥端通过销固定,排肥舌往上翘,在排肥轮停止转动的情况,保证肥料不下落。The fertilizer discharge tongue is installed under the fertilizer wheel, one end is fixed on the shell by a pin, and the other end is the lower fertilizer end is fixed by a pin, and the fertilizer discharge tongue is tilted upwards to ensure that the fertilizer does not fall when the fertilizer discharge wheel stops rotating.

本实施例中所有轴承采用惯用技术,轴肩、轴套、挡圈来实现定位;并都采用了轴承端盖来减少外界土壤等对轴承损坏。All the bearings in this embodiment adopt conventional technology, shaft shoulders, shaft sleeves, and retaining rings to realize positioning; and all adopt bearing end covers to reduce external soil and other damage to the bearings.

如图2c,机架采用主梁和左连接板、右连接板焊接成三角形(纵截面),方便施肥装置安装和加固机架;两侧和尾部都可以安装塑料挡土板来防止土壤散飞。As shown in Figure 2c, the frame adopts the main beam and the left connecting plate and the right connecting plate to form a triangle (longitudinal section) welded to facilitate the installation of the fertilization device and strengthen the frame; plastic retaining plates can be installed on both sides and the tail to prevent the soil from flying .

本实施例的工作过程是:从拖拉机通过链条输入动力到动力输入齿轮,在压缩弹簧的作用下,牙嵌离合器将动力传输到输出齿轮通过链条输入到旋耕动力输入齿轮,带动旋耕轴旋转,旋转刀片在慢速情况完成松土和在高速情况下完成开沟;通过旋转把手,调节螺纹轴的上下旋转来改变地轮距机架高度,固定螺栓固定后,实现土壤松土开沟的深度调节,完成浅耕松土、深耕松土、浅开沟和深开沟。The working process of this embodiment is: input power from the tractor through the chain to the power input gear, under the action of the compression spring, the jaw clutch transmits the power to the output gear and inputs the power to the rotary tillage power input gear through the chain, driving the rotary tiller shaft to rotate , the rotary blade completes the loosening of the soil at a slow speed and completes the ditching at a high speed; by rotating the handle, adjusting the up and down rotation of the threaded shaft to change the height of the ground track frame, and after the fixing bolts are fixed, the soil loosening and ditching can be realized Depth adjustment, complete shallow plowing loose soil, deep plowing loose soil, shallow ditching and deep ditching.

正常工作状态:牙嵌离合器啮合,松土开沟工作;施肥装置工作,实施施肥;通过附件调节旋转耕深,完成调量浅施肥和调量深施肥。Normal working state: the jaw clutch is engaged, soil loosening and ditching work; the fertilization device is working, and fertilization is carried out; the rotary plowing depth is adjusted through the attachment, and the shallow fertilization and deep fertilization are completed.

第二种工作状态说明:在道路行驶时,牙嵌离合器分离,松土开沟不工作;通过附件调高机架高度,使旋转刀片不与地面作用,地轮作为从动轮。The second working state description: when driving on the road, the jaw clutch is disengaged, and the soil loosening and ditching does not work; the height of the frame is adjusted through the accessories, so that the rotating blade does not interact with the ground, and the ground wheel is used as a driven wheel.

第三种工作状态说明:结构同前,不同之处在于:牙嵌离合器分离,松土开沟不工作;打开直流电机开关,并调节电机转速,通过电机齿轮带动施肥驱动齿轮、施肥轴和拨肥轮转动,在拨肥轮的转动下,不断施肥,通过下肥管施入土壤中,实施调量浅施肥;在实践中,下肥管和底部犁式开沟器强度高,可实现一定深度的调量施肥。Description of the third working state: the structure is the same as before, the difference is that the jaw clutch is separated, and the soil loosening and ditching does not work; the DC motor switch is turned on, and the motor speed is adjusted, and the fertilization drive gear, fertilization shaft and dial are driven by the motor gear. The fertilizer wheel rotates, and under the rotation of the fertilizer wheel, fertilization is continuously applied, and it is applied into the soil through the lower fertilizer pipe to implement shallow fertilization; in practice, the lower fertilizer pipe and the bottom plow opener have high strength, which can achieve a certain Depth adjustment of fertilization.

第四种工作状态说明:结构同前,不同之处在于:将地轮卸下后,通过连接板连接覆土器在螺纹轴上;牙嵌离合器啮合,松土开沟工作;施肥装置工作,实施施肥,通过附件调节旋转耕深,实施中、深调量施肥和覆土。Description of the fourth working state: The structure is the same as before, the difference is that after the ground wheel is removed, the soil covering device is connected to the threaded shaft through the connecting plate; the jaw clutch is engaged, and the soil is loosened and ditching; Fertilization, adjust the rotary tillage depth through the attachment, and implement medium and deep adjustment of fertilization and soil covering.
